Observation of unstable waves around a dipole magnet in a weakly magnetized plasma

Spatially localized unstable waves are observed around a dipole magnet in a low-density plasma. The observed wave frequency (≅150--200 kHz) with a high fluctuation level (≅20%) is much higher than an ion-cyclotron frequency. Correlation measurements confirm azimuthal propagation of the unstable wave on the axis of the dipole magnet. The calculation using a fluid model is found to account qualitatively for the results, and predicts that the waves are excited by two stream instabilities ascribed to an electron drift caused by the density and the potential gradients perpendicular to the magnetic field
